The game:

The Thing picks up where the 1982 film "left" off...

The Thing picks up where the 1982 film ''left'' off 'center'ing on the military investigation of enigmatic deaths of an American scientific team in the frozen wastelands of the Antarctic. Within these inhospitable surroundings your team encounters a strange shape-shifting alien life-form that assumes the appearance of people that it kills. Capitalizing on the fear and intense paranoia portrayed in the film, The Thing will deliver a new gaming experience blending player controlled, squad-based action and horror elements for the first time. Through the use of an innovative Trust Fear NPC management system, the player must monitor and influence his fellow NPC squad members psychological state throughout the game. Using all your team members is critical if you hope to accomplish objectives, let alone survive. Now if you only knew which ones were still human…

The Thing infects gamers with isolation and paranoia in third quarter 2002Universal Interactive to transform survival/horror gaming on next generation platforms

Universal City, Calif., January 14, 2001 - Get ready for unprecedented levels of fear and suspense as Universal Interactive has unveiled its plans for The Thing for Microsoft Xbox®, PlayStation®2 computer entertainment system, and PC CD-ROM scheduled for release in third quarter 2002. The Xbox® and PlayStation®2 computer entertainment system games will be co-published with Konami Corporation.

Universal Interactive's The Thing, a game inspired by Universal Studios' and John Carpenter's classic horror film of the same name, picks up where the movie left off and features an all-new cast of characters.

You are a military squad captain sent into the frozen Antarctic to investigate the mysterious deaths of an American scientific expedition. Are you a trustworthy leader? Are your fellow soldiers really on your side? Are they even human? London-based game developer Computer Artworks, Ltd. has created a revolutionary gameplay mechanic never before implemented in the survival/horror genre: an advanced trust/fear interface enabling you to monitor the psychological states of the non-playing characters (NPC's) which in turn determine whether these characters cooperate with you. Unlike most survival/horror games, The Thing demands that you work with your increasingly suspicious teammates, relying on wits and an arsenal of weaponry, including flame-throwers and machine guns, to escape infection and finish the game with your squad.

"The Thing is a phenomenal license that lends itself incredibly well to adaptation as a game," said Jim Wilson, president of Universal Interactive. "This innovative, multi-platform title provides fans of The Thing the sequel they have been waiting to see for 20 years."

The ultra-realistic 3-D game also features groundbreaking snow and lighting effects, subtle sound cues and some of the most hyper-detailed and truly horrific creatures ever to grace the gaming screen. The Thing is difficult to see, hard to kill and seemingly impossible to evade. Are you ready?

About "The Thing"

Derived from John W. Campbell, Jr.'s short story "Who Goes There?" and a remake of Howard Hawks' 1951 film, John Carpenter's ("Christine," "Halloween") The Thing has become a cult phenomenon since its theatrical release in 1982. Telling the story of an alien monster that ravages an Antarctic outpost with its power to morph into the shape of anything it kills, the film was rated by Entertainment Weekly as the 12th-scariest movie of all time, in the company of such classics as "Alien" and "The Exorcist."
